AndroidManifest.xml

<uses-library android:name="android.test.runner"/>

<instrumentation
android:name="android.test.InstrumentationTestRunner"
android:targetPackage="com.myapp.tests"
android:label="MyAppTests" />

1.繼承androidTestCase類。
2.Assert類判斷所得到值與期望值是否相同。

按一下「Android JUnit Test」運行後會,會出現如下警告:
It outputs Warning: No instrumentation runner found for the launch, using
android.test.InstrumentationTestRunner.
模擬器不能記住Androidmanifest的配置,在運行時需要重新設置回合組態,如下:
1.在工程名字上點擊右鍵,選擇properties
2.在Run/Debug setting中選擇要運行的工程名字,點擊右邊的Edit,會進入下面的介面,
在 instrumentation runner後面的下拉清單中選擇:android.test.InstrumentationTestRunner
3.重新運行該測試單元,則就不會出現上面的警告了。





REFERENCES:HTTP://www.cnblogs.com/tjpfly/archive/2011/05/25/2056717.html
創作者介紹
創作者 shadow 的頭像
shadow

資訊園

shadow 發表在 痞客邦 留言(0) 人氣()